Conquering the Salesforce Budget Beast: Effective License Cost Management Strategies

Salesforce's robust functionality is a powerful tool for businesses, but its broad range of licenses can quickly become a budget burden. To avoid overspending, organizations must implement effective strategies to manage their Salesforce expenditure. A key first step is conducting a thorough audit of your current licenses to identify any areas where redundancy exists. This allows for the reduction of unnecessary licenses and redistribution of resources to more essential roles.

  • Furthermore, consider implementing a structured licensing policy that outlines clear guidelines for user access and license allocation. This helps to guarantee that licenses are only granted to those who require them, minimizing the risk of unused spending.
  • Moreover, explore Salesforce's adaptable licensing options. For example, consider user-based or volume-based subscriptions that align with your organization's specific needs and factors.

Finally, regularly review your Salesforce licensing strategy to ensure it remains aligned with your business goals. By strategically managing your permissions, you can tame the budget beast and unlock the full potential of Salesforce without breaking the bank.

Scaling Your Business with Salesforce Editions

Choosing the optimal Salesforce edition can feel like a daunting task. With numerous choices available, it's crucial to identify the solution that efficiently aligns with your individual business needs.

Evaluate factors like company magnitude, user count, and primary functionalities. A comprehensive understanding of your existing processes and future goals will lead you towards the best Salesforce edition for your stride.

  • Investigate the various editions, such as Essentials, Professional, Enterprise, and Unlimited.
  • Analyze key features and limitations of each edition.
  • Reach out Salesforce experts or trusted partners for personalized recommendations.

In conclusion, the appropriate Salesforce edition empowers your business to prosper in a competitive landscape.
